首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ql重启后数据库不见

当MySQL重启后,数据库不可见的问题可能有以下几个可能的原因和解决方法:

  1. 数据库配置问题:检查MySQL的配置文件my.cnf,确保数据库文件目录和日志目录的路径配置正确。另外,也要确认是否有设置正确的数据库权限。
  2. 数据库文件损坏:MySQL数据库文件可能发生损坏导致数据库不可见。在这种情况下,可以尝试使用MySQL自带的工具如mysqlcheck进行修复操作。
  3. 数据库服务启动问题:检查MySQL服务是否已成功启动。可以通过检查系统服务状态或者尝试手动启动MySQL服务来解决。
  4. 数据库表空间问题:MySQL数据库使用表空间来存储数据,可能由于表空间配置错误或者损坏导致数据库不可见。可以尝试使用InnoDB引擎的恢复工具如innodb_force_recovery来修复表空间。
  5. 数据库日志文件问题:MySQL的日志文件可能损坏或者出错导致数据库不可见。在这种情况下,可以尝试备份并删除日志文件,然后重新启动MySQL服务。

总结起来,当MySQL重启后数据库不可见,需要检查数据库配置、文件损坏、服务启动、表空间以及日志文件等问题,并采取相应的修复措施。如果问题仍然存在,建议参考相关MySQL的官方文档或者咨询专业的数据库管理员进行解决。

腾讯云相关产品推荐:

  • 腾讯云数据库 MySQL:提供高性能、可扩展、安全可靠的MySQL数据库服务。产品介绍链接: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云云服务器(CVM):提供弹性可扩展的云服务器,适用于搭建数据库服务器和应用程序的环境。产品介绍链接:https://cloud.tencent.com/product/cvm
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券